Application of low-height road lighting scheme in U-shaped trough interchange project

The intersection of Yuhang Century Avenue and 09 Provincial Highway in Hangzhou is located at the junction of Nanyuan Street and Qiaosi Town in the southwest corner of Linping City. The current situation is T-shaped level crossing.

The transformation design plan is to go through the Century Avenue on the main line of Provincial Highway 09, and set up the auxiliary road to communicate with Century Avenue. The length of the 09 provincial road is 770 meters. The lower section structure is provided with open section U-shaped groove and dark buried section box culvert. The main structure of the railway box culvert remains unchanged. Only the existing non-motor vehicle culverts and new pipeline box culverts on the west side are partially reconstructed. The motor vehicle lane clearance is 5 meters, and the non-machine and sidewalk clearance is 2.5 meters. After the transformation, Provincial Highway No. 09 and Century Avenue are the main roads of the city. The designed speed is 60 km/h for the main line and 40 km/h for the auxiliary line. The design period is 15 years for the asphalt pavement, 100 years for the bridge and culvert, and the project land area is about 14 mu. The investment is 106 million yuan.

The implementation of the project has positive significance for improving the traffic capacity of the intersection, improving driving conditions and reducing vehicle fuel consumption.

Lighting Design

Scheme design one:

The original design uses conventional street lighting in accordance with the current lighting scheme. The specific arrangement is to use the road in the U-shaped trough section to pick up the street light, and the ground auxiliary road adopts one pick and one hanging street light to illuminate the motor vehicle lane and the non-motor vehicle lane and the sidewalk respectively, and the intersection adopts a high pole light. The tunnel section (the frame box culvert part) is illuminated by a dedicated tunnel light, arranged in a double row, located at the chamfer of the frame structure.

The reconstruction projects of the various sections of the 09 Provincial Highway and the Century Avenue (09 Provincial Highway ~ Shida Line) project have all adopted the conventional high pole light style. This arrangement can maintain the overall consistency, but in the U-shaped groove section. The middle double-pick high pole light is gradually reduced relative to the ground, which has a certain influence on the overall landscape and style.

Scheme design two:

The design of the tunnel section (frame box culvert part) is the same as that of the scheme 1. For the U-shaped trough section, according to the current treatment of several similar projects in Hangzhou, the lighting fixtures are installed on the side wall of the U-shaped trough, and the tunnel light is usually installed. With embedded installation). However, this type of installation has problems such as insufficient road illumination, especially uneven illumination. The main reason is that the current conventional lamps (including tunnel lights) are designed according to the high-bar installation method, and the range of illumination can be guaranteed only at a certain installation height.

A similar problem exists in the U-slot portion of other tunnels. Through various market research, the designer has carried out detailed design of the lighting of the U-shaped groove part, especially the careful study of the lamp part, and proposed the following design.

In the U-slot range, Thorn's latest low-bar light ORUS lighting scheme is used, and the installation height of the fixture is only 90cm away from the road surface. This kind of luminaire adopts the revolutionary Flat Beam flat-light patent technology, which has better floodlighting effect and ensures the illumination and uniformity of the road surface. Since the concealed height is only 90cm, which is lower than the normal driving line of sight, glare can be effectively avoided, and the later maintenance is very convenient, which can effectively avoid the impact of street lamp maintenance on traffic.

At present, such lamps are used in Shenzhen, Wuhan, Changzhou and Taiyuan, and are mainly used for lighting in interchanges. Since the height of the street lamp is only 90cm, the street light pole is basically invisible, which is also advantageous for the road landscape. The U-shaped groove range is equipped with low-light pole lighting fixtures in the central isolation zone, and the street lights of the ground auxiliary roads are still arranged with conventional high pole lights. The layout of the scheme avoids the poor visual effect of the high and low undulations of the high-light poles on the road. The streetlights installed by the low-light poles have good visual orientation; the ground-guided high-light poles can be consistent with the front and rear standard sections and the Century Avenue.

Intersection and interior lighting:

The range of this intersection is relatively large. It is recommended to use the four-corner arrangement of high pole lights to illuminate the intersection range. The professional tunnel lighting is used in the frame to ensure the lighting effect.

The final implementation effect:

The project was completed at the end of November 2010. Due to the short pole, the fixtures are very concealed. The impact on the overall landscape during the day is very small. If the dealers do not pay attention, they will not feel the presence of street lamps. But in the evening, the light from the luminaires sends a sharp light, and the road surface is very clear, which provides great convenience for driving induction and safety.
